Average Arts, Design, Entertainment, Sports, and Media Occupations Salary in U.S.

In U.S., professionals in Arts, Design, Entertainment, Sports, and Media Occupations earn an average annual salary of $77,720.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 1,889,440 employees in the U.S. area with a job density of per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
